Indian Wells Celebrity Course
Polished resort
Celebrity is polished and comfortable. A good fit for resort-focused groups, especially when the trip needs less punishment.

Google review
5/5 - 9 months ago
We were visiting from the NE during summer.
Only the Celebrity Course was open, the Professional was closed for rehab.
The course is not cheap but it is challenging and gorgeous.
The course is immaculately maintained.
The only issue was the 105deg heat, but that's not the resorts
